Output ce013dea49629279f6c83d5ebc40d44aa6816c08528bac10aeae24bf2b5ec610:1

value
670922386
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 50fff3e9c8aaecb9b1c3063ddd20314ed273d31d OP_EQUALVERIFY OP_CHECKSIG
address
18PHgFxAejNhARs3J4XwpSPSaBvBdVYBqc
transaction
ce013dea49629279f6c83d5ebc40d44aa6816c08528bac10aeae24bf2b5ec610
spent
true